How to Get to Weymouth

Plane

Although Weymouth doesn’t have its own airport, you can fly to Southampton Airport (SOU), which is located 86 km from Weymouth. Bristol Airport is the most popular, with regular flights from easyJet, Loganair, British Airways and other airlines departing from the United Kingdom. The shortest domestic flight to Weymouth departs from London and takes around 9h 55m.

Train

AccesRail is the most popular train carrier serving Weymouth, followed by Cross Country. The train journey from Weymouth to London takes 2h 00m and costs around £40 for a one-way ticket. When coming by train from Liverpool, expect to pay about £56 for a 5h 05m trip. Located 4 km from the city centre, Weymouth Upwey is the busiest station in Weymouth. Another popular train station is Weymouth, located 0.7 km from the centre.

Car

Another option to get to Weymouth is to pick up a car hire from London, which is about 190 km from Weymouth. You’ll find branches of GREEN MOTION and SURPRICE CAR RENTAL , among others, in London.

Bus

National Express operates bus routes to Weymouth. From London, the bus ride to Weymouth takes 201 km and will cost you around £22. From Birmingham, the ticket costs about £26 for a journey of 491 km. The most popular bus station is Weymouth Weymouth, located 0.6 km from the city centre of Weymouth. Weymouth Weymouth is also a commonly used station, and is 0.7 km from the city centre.
